Gudiz is a full-service digital agency founded in 2014 with a team of under 49 specialists. They offer web design, development, e-commerce, SEO, social media marketing, graphic design, video production, and branding services. The agency is based in Marrakesh, Morocco.

Kudos is an independent PR and communications agency based in Copenhagen with a strong Nordic network. The agency helps clients bring their stories to life through public relations, branding, and storytelling.
